Simple Resolution
A form of legislative measure introduced and potentially acted upon by only one congressional chamber and used for the regulation of business only within the chamber of origin. Depending on the chamber of origin, they begin with a designation of either H.Res. or S.Res. Joint resolutions and concurrent resolutions are other types of resolutions.

Summary
This resolution authorizes official photographs of the House of Representatives to be taken while the House is in actual session, on a date designated by the Speaker.
